Barnsdall (zip 74002), Oklahoma gets 44 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38 inches of rain per year.
Barnsdall (zip 74002) averages 9 inches of snow per year. The US average is 28 inches of snow per year.
On average, there are 230 sunny days per year in Barnsdall (zip 74002). The US average is 205 sunny days.
Barnsdall (zip 74002) gets some kind of precipitation, on average, 77 days per year. Precipitation is rain, snow, sleet, or hail that falls to the ground. In order for precipitation to be counted you have to get at least .01 inches on the ground to measure.
